My name is Sophia Colombo. I am the youngest daughter of the Colombo family, one of Newarke City's most powerful Mafia dynasties. My father is the Don, and my three older brothers control most of the family's operations across the Rooklyn, Kings, and Canhatte boroughs. On the Veste Coast district, the name Colombo commands power and fear. My best friend, Jennifer, always says I've been too sheltered by my family, that I can't see through a man's lies or schemes. She even offered to "help" me put that to the test. So, under the guise of looking out for me, she seduced my fiancé. After winning him over, she stood there, smug and self-satisfied, watching me like I was the punchline to a joke. "I told you—you're too naive," she said. "Those men are all cunning and full of tricks. If it weren't for me, you'd have been fooled into tears a hundred times over." I was furious—so angry I could barely breathe—but I couldn't find a single word to argue back. This time, I chose my fiancé in secret, keeping it from her entirely. He was the heir to the Lucia family. And just as I expected, the moment she found out… she made her move again. What she didn't know was that this fiancé was someone I had carefully prepared… just for her.

Chapter 1

Chapter 1

In an upscale apartment in Canhatte, Jennifer was holding up a photo of herself with my former fiancé, Marcello, flaunting it with undisguised pride.

"Back when he was chasing you, he swore he'd marry no one but you. And now? All I had to do was crook my finger, and he came running to me. Lucky for you I stepped in, right? Otherwise, you'd have been fooled all over again."

I clenched my fists, a suffocating pressure building in my chest.

"You knowingly went after someone else's fiancé and still act this self-righteous. Do you have any shame at all?"

Jennifer froze for a moment, then quickly put on a wounded expression.

"Sophia, I was trying to protect you from getting hurt. How can you not see that?"

Lucy immediately jumped in to defend her.

"Sophia, you're way too gullible. Is it really worth ruining your friendship over a man?"

"Exactly," Annie chimed in. "If it weren't for Jennifer, who knows how many times you would've been deceived? She's helping you filter out the trash. You should be thanking her."

I opened my mouth, but not a single word came out. It was true—none of my five former fiancés were decent men. But how much better was Jennifer?

Before breaking off each engagement, I had secretly checked their phones.

Jennifer had sent them countless explicit photos—every set of lingerie she wore was practically see-through. She even asked them, "Do you want to hear what I sound like in bed?"

The whole thing disgusted me.

Jennifer leaned closer, her voice laced with smug satisfaction.

"Sophia, you're not actually mad, are you? I didn't expect things to turn out like this. I was just casually chatting with them, and they all fell for me. That's not my fault, is it?"

Lucy nodded along.

"Of course it's not your fault. It just means you're charming. Not like some girl who thinks being a Principessa means every man in the world will fall at her feet."

Lucy and Annie exchanged a knowing glance, smiling to each other.

I ignored their petty scheme and turned back to my phone.

The spacious apartment fell silent for a few seconds.

Then Lucy suddenly shrieked, "Oh my God—look who that is!"

She pressed herself against the balcony window, craning her neck to look down.

"That's William Lucia! Why is the heir to the Lucia family downstairs?"

Annie and Jennifer rushed over immediately.

"No way—it really is him! What's he doing at our building? Don't tell me he's waiting for his girlfriend?"

"Oh my God, who's that lucky? That's William Lucia—the one person no one on the entire Veste Coast district dares to cross."

As if struck by a thought, Lucy turned to Jennifer.

"Jennifer, weren't you close to William back then? Does he have a girlfriend now?"

Jennifer's expression shifted, but she said nothing. Back then, she had chased after William for over half a year and never even managed to get his private number.

I finished applying my lipstick in front of the mirror and got ready to leave.

Jennifer grabbed my arm.

"Didn't you already break up with Marcello? Are you still going out to meet him?"

I shook her off.

"It's been three months since I dumped him. If you like that kind of trash, feel free to keep him."

My phone suddenly rang, and I picked up at once.

A deep, low voice came through the line. "Are you there, baby? I'm downstairs."

"I'll be right down."

I was about to hang up when my phone was suddenly snatched from my hand. Jennifer shot me a glare.

"No wonder you dumped Marcello. You've already found someone new."

Then, in a deliberately sweetened voice, she spoke into my phone.

"Hello, I'm Sophia's best friend, Jennifer. Are you her fiancé?"

Whatever the person on the other end said, her smile froze instantly.

Seizing the moment while she was stunned, I grabbed my phone back and hung up.

A storm of jealousy surged in Jennifer's eyes as she stared at me.

"Your new fiancé… is William Lucia?"
